Morning All,

 

Black 5 45407 took the 'Cathedrals Express' from Southend to Salisbury yesterday, deputising for the unavailable B1 61306 which was at the menders.

Took my son to see 45407 at the slightly less glamorous Leytonstone High Road station. There were about 15-20 adults, mostly with small children, to see the train pass. Small children heard to observe "I want to see another one now" and that child's father, friends of ours, observed that it was bigger and more impressive than they'd expected. Interestingly, the reason why so many small children were there was due to social media. My wife and our nanny both belong to a local mother and child group on Facebook who publicised it.

 

Unfortunately, the station announcer got the platform and direction of the train wrong. They'd said the train was at Blackhorse Road and about 5 mins away whereas the train was coming from Barking which is the opposite direction. I presume that's where their control room is and they'd misinterpreted what they'd been told. We were nearly blocked by a freight train running the other way but fortunately that passed a minute before the express.

 

Despite a green signal, 45407 came to a halt almost in front of us which gave the added advantage of a restart and a bit longer to admire the loco and stock.
